7e is a novel flavanone derivative with potential antipsychotic effects. It has been shown to decrease the activity of dopamine D2 receptors in HEK293 cells and inhibit the over-production of nitric oxide stimulated by lipopolysaccharide/interferon-γ in BV-2 microglial cells. In mice, intragastric administration of 7e reversed the increase in locomotor activity induced by MK-801 and decreased the hyperactivity of climbing behavior induced by apomorphine, suggesting its potential utility in the treatment of schizophrenia.
